In a recent article via the philosophical magazine Aeon, Rachel O'Dwyeris, a writer and lecturer in digital cultures at the National College of Art and Design in Dublin and author of Tokens: The Future of Money in the Age of the Platform, has written about cryptocurrencies as Bitcoin. 

The first part discusses using compelling narratives, like those portrayed in Crypto.com's Super Bowl ads, to promote cryptocurrencies as pathways to wealth and success. It contrasts these narratives with the harsh reality many investors face, highlighting the volatility and risks involved in crypto investment.

It then delves into the historical context of cryptocurrencies, tracing their origins to the aftermath of the 2008 financial crisis and their evolution from niche communities to mainstream investment options. It also explores how cryptocurrencies were framed as financial inclusion and empowerment opportunities, particularly for marginalized communities like Black Americans.

The text further examines the phenomenon of retail trading, mainly popularized during the COVID-19 pandemic, and its connection to broader societal trends, such as disillusionment with traditional pathways to success and the search for alternative means of financial security.

The concept of "cruel optimism" is introduced. It describes the desire for something that ultimately harms us and how it manifests in various aspects of modern life, including financial speculation.

The narrative shifts to a discussion of generational experiences and the impact of economic instability on millennials and Gen Z, who grew up amidst financial crises and face uncertain futures. It reflects the shift from traditional notions of success and security to more speculative and risky investment strategies.

Ultimately, the text portrays financial markets as detached from reality, driven by nihilistic and desperate sentiments, where the pursuit of security has become akin to gambling for survival in a world devoid of traditional dreams and futures.

I understand O'Dwyeris's criticism, but I'm afraid I have to disagree with most of the content and arguments. There are several reasons for that. 

Cryptocurrencies have emerged as a transformative force in the global financial landscape, offering innovative solutions to traditional problems and empowering individuals with financial sovereignty. While some critics may raise concerns about the volatility, regulatory uncertainty, and environmental impact of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, it's essential to recognize the broader benefits and opportunities they bring to the table.

First and foremost, cryptocurrencies represent a paradigm shift towards decentralization and democratization of finance. Unlike traditional currencies, which are subject to the control of central authorities and susceptible to inflation and manipulation, cryptocurrencies operate on decentralized blockchain networks. This decentralization ensures transparency, immutability, and security, making them a reliable store of value and medium of exchange.

Moreover, cryptocurrencies foster financial inclusion by providing access to financial services for billions of unbanked and underbanked individuals worldwide. With a smartphone and internet connection, anyone can participate in the global economy, send and receive remittances, access loans, and engage in commerce without traditional banking infrastructure.

Contrary to claims about high transaction fees, cryptocurrencies often offer lower costs for cross-border transactions than traditional banking systems. This cost-effectiveness makes cryptocurrencies attractive for international remittances and cross-border trade, particularly in regions where traditional banking services are expensive or inaccessible.

While critics may highlight the volatility of cryptocurrencies, it's essential to recognize that volatility is a natural feature of emerging asset classes. Over time, as adoption and liquidity increase, cryptocurrencies will likely become more stable and less prone to price fluctuations. Furthermore, volatility presents opportunities for traders and investors to profit from price movements, contributing to market liquidity and efficiency.

Regarding regulatory concerns, it's crucial to distinguish between legitimate regulatory oversight to protect investors and consumers and overzealous or restrictive regulations that stifle innovation and growth. Appropriately crafted regulations can provide clarity and legitimacy to the cryptocurrency industry, fostering trust and confidence among market participants while safeguarding against illicit activities.

Concerns about the environmental impact of cryptocurrency mining should be stated and understood more. While it's true that some cryptocurrencies, particularly Bitcoin, consume energy-intensive mining processes, innovative solutions such as renewable energy sources and more efficient mining algorithms are mitigating these concerns. 

Additionally, the environmental impact of traditional financial systems, including banking infrastructure and cash production, must be considered in any comparative analysis.

Thanks to decentralization, fostering financial inclusion, promoting innovation, and addressing regulatory challenges collaboratively, cryptocurrencies can play a pivotal role in creating a more inclusive, efficient, and resilient financial system for the future.
